In Washington Township (Gloucester County), the Grenloch Fire Company operates Power Wagon 1015. It is a 2001 Ford F-450 XL Super Duty/G & S Fabricators with NJFFS specs. It has a brush guard, Hale 250-gpm pump with 18 hp Vanguard motor, 300-gallon water tank, 1 ½-inch forestry hose reel, three whip lines, one-inch booster reel, Ramsey 6-ton front winch, brush coats, fire shelters, BLS bag, two Indian tanks, rope, hand fire extinguishers, Rigid spotlights, brooms, shovels and hand tools.
